Definitions
In certain sports, as in tennis or long jump, a fault in which the athlete's foot is in the wrong place at the wrong time.

Examples
“In tennis, a foot fault results when server's foot is placed outside the service area prior to the ball being hit.”
“In pickleball, a foot fault occurs when a player volleys a ball while in the kitchen, or non-volley zone.”
